ある長さの文字列の右側に別の文字列を挿入した結果を返します。左側を特定の文字で埋めることもできます。パディング文字が挿入されていない場合は、空白がパディングとして使用されます。
RIGHT(s,l,c)
RIGHT は、長さ l の文字列の右側に文字列 s を挿入した結果の文字列を返します。オプションのパディング文字 c を左側に挿入することもできます。挿入しない場合は、空白がパディングとして使用されます。
dcl s char (40) var; dcl t char (40) var; s = 'This string is 33 characters long'; t = right(s, 40, '+'); put skip list (t);
次のように表示されます。
+++++++This string is 33 characters long
なし。